How they compare
Greece currently reports 1.0% against 0.9% in Guyana, a difference of 0.1%.
That makes Greece's figure about 1.2 times Guyana's.
Across all 8 years both countries report, Guyana has been ahead every year.
Greece ranks 110th and Guyana ranks 112th of 190 countries.
Guyana has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Greece | Guyana |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 1.2% | 4.1% | 2.9% | Guyana |
| 1980s | 0.2% | 2.1% | 1.9% | Guyana |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
